Albania is a tiny but cute country on the Mediterranean, close to Greece. Albania is quite possibly the least visited Mediterranean countries but that will change before you know it as more and more travellers appreciate its splendour. Albania has exceptional, white sandy beaches, more of less virgin mountain regions, and vibrant, growing cities.

Albania’s sandy beaches are exceptional. These beaches are mainly white, sandy beaches except there are a dozen pebble beaches as well. You could either lie down in the bright sun on a blanket or hire a sun bed, the option is up to you. Many of the beaches are totally untouched by foreign visitors and a handful are so remote that you could possibly have the beach pretty much all to yourself, even in in during popular times.

There are numerous mountain regions in Albania. Those in the north are great for skiing or hiking and you can find plenty of waterfalls and spectacular lakes in the area. The mountains in that region are brilliant to view but the other mountain regions are also brilliant.

Albanian cities are vibrant with a cafe culture leading to so many great cafes to hang out in. Albania cities for example Saranda are worth spending a few days in to see the unusual old city area and not to mention to visit a few museums.

Most Albanian people are extremely friendly and will be more than pleased to take you around their country if you are there.
